Haddock Fillet with Citrus Marinade
| Preparation: | 10 min |
| Marinating/Waiting: | 20 min |
| Cooking: | 10 min |
| Total: | 40 min |

Recipe ingredients
- Citrus Marinade
- 2 Tbsp. (30 mL) lemon juice
- 2 Tbsp. (30 mL) Irresistibles grapefruit juice*
- 2 Tbsp. (30 mL) Irresistibles orange juice*
- 2 tsp. (10 mL) sesame oil
- 3 Tbsp. (45 mL) Irresistibles extra virgin olive oil*
- 4 x 4 oz ( 4 x 120 g) fresh haddock fillets
- 1 Tbsp. (15 mL) lemon juice
- 1 tsp. (5 mL) salt
Preparation
In a glass dish, mix marinade ingredients together.
Add haddock fillets, cover and refrigerate for 20 minutes.
Remove delicately and drain fillets.
In a pan, bring some water to a boil.
Add lemon juice and salt.
Arrange fillets without overlapping in a steaming basket and place over simmering liquid, which must not touch the bottom of the basket.
Cover and cook 10 minutes.
